Top 5 players who didn't make the cut for McDonald's All-American Game


On Tuesday, the McDonald’s All-American Game rosters were announced, and while it was a day of celebration for the 24 players selected, there were talented players left off of the coveted list. Let’s take a look at the top five “snubs” for this year’s McDonald’s All-American Game: T.J. Power, , Gavin Griffiths, , and Dennis Evans. (Rivals.com)
